Transaction 61d7597789c78f45a19ded101ea8b206071c3b0ad56b0adfcc86f34ced3eaab4
1 Input
2 Outputs
- 61d7597789c78f45a19ded101ea8b206071c3b0ad56b0adfcc86f34ced3eaab4:0
- 61d7597789c78f45a19ded101ea8b206071c3b0ad56b0adfcc86f34ced3eaab4:1
value 124345310
address 168sZzg79WGnHysnSw85L3Y5H8rDnD7fzH
value 6006263323
address 1H1qw2ecRhArCaNMPF9p5j3dehkoNAn1ua